Today was the launch of the iPhone 3G and the 2.0 software. Large groups of people lined outside the Apple Stores quickly before the 8:00 AM sale time. AT&T got involved in the activation process and decided they wanted all customers' purchases to be activated in-store. Instead, the servers weren't ready for the demand. Transactions couldn't be handled, and a 10-15 minute process turned out to be twenty minute to an hour per customer.
I eventually got my iPhone untouched by the Apple employees, ready for me to take home and activate. This is the process...
